16.002 Definitions. In this chapter:

16.002(1) (1) "Department" means the department of administration.

16.002(2) (2) "Departments" means constitutional offices, departments, and independent agencies and includes all societies, associations, and other agencies of state government for which appropriations are made by law, but not including authorities created in subch. II of ch. 114 or in ch. 231, 232, 233, 234, 237, 238, or 279.

16.002(3) (3) "Position" means a group of duties and responsibilities in either the classified or the unclassified divisions of the civil service, which require the services of an employee on a part-time or full-time basis.

16.002(4) (4) "Secretary" means the secretary of administration.

History: 1977 c. 196; 1983 a. 27, 189; 2001 a. 16; 2005 a. 74, 335; 2007 a. 20, 97; 2009 a. 28; 2011 a. 7, 10, 229; 2013 a. 20, 165.
